I am a Christian/Follower of Jesus Christ/Yeshua Messiah.

I believe that the bible is the word of God and helps us become more like Him the more we let the Holy Spirit change our thinking and so ultimately our behaviou/actions.

“For the word of God is alive and active. Sharper than any double-edged sword, it penetrates even to dividing soul and spirit, joints and marrow; it judges the thoughts and attitudes of the heart” Hebrews 4:12

I believe in the Triune God; Father, Son and Holy Spirit.

I believe God’s nature is pure love (Agape love).

“God is love. Whoever lives in love lives in God, and God in them.” 1 John 4:16

I believe Jesus came and was born as a human being and lived among us over 2000 years ago. He was fully God the Son but also fully human (He experienced the same temptations and frailty as we do) and He taught us the way we can live to love God and others through the power of the Holy Spirit. He also crucially came to take our sins and infirmities upon himself when he was crucified on the cross so we can have a relationship with Him. We are saved from the just punishment we deserved for our sins because Jesus lived a sinless life, shed His blood, died on the cross and rose to life again after 3 days. In so doing He made the way for us to become a new creation/born again (dying to our old self and receiving the Holy Spirit) in Him. God the Father no longer sees us as tarnished by sin. Instead, if we receive Jesus as our Lord and Saviour, by repenting and turning away from our sins and believing what He did on the cross for us and that He rose again, we are made a new creation/born again (We receive the Holy Spirit).
